Carolina Cudemus-Jones, director of design and construction management, served as the master of ceremonies and moderator of a panel discussion at this year’s Women Who Build Summit held Feb. 21 at Goodwin College in East Hartford.

The Women Who Build Summit is organized by The Construction Institute of the University of Hartford and attended by architects, engineers, contractors, lawyers, accountants and other professionals in the construction industry. The annual event promotes the strength and rise of women in the construction industry.

Cudemus-Jones moderated the discussion, “A Candid Conversation with the C-Suite: How to Change the Paradigm? Potential Versus Performance,” with authoritative members of the regional construction industry including: Laura Cruickshank, associate vice president of the Planning, Design and Construct Department at the University of Connecticut; Patricia Filippone, executive director at University of Massachusetts Building Authority; Kevin Grigg, president and chief executive officer at Fuss & O'Neill, Inc.; and Frank Haynes, chief operating officer and president of the building division at BOND Brothers, Inc. These “C-suite” executives will share their opinions on what abilities and qualities are needed to make it to the corner office, how to cultivate leadership qualities and what candidates can do to show their leadership team that they are up to the task.

Mireya “Carolina” Cudemus-Jones joined UMass Amherst in October of 2018. Most recently with Gilbane Building Company, Cudemus has more than 20 years of experience in complex private and public commercial construction projects, including health care, higher education and K-12 schools. She serves on the board of directors of the Construction Institute and is active with the Connecticut Professional Women in Construction.
